I wish I had more damn time to help you noobs out :tease: Anyway, the reason why those TB screws gets stripped is mostly becaues you used the wrong sized phillips head. If you spray the TB down for a day or two before you take the screws out and use the appropriate sized phillips head (push down REALLY HARD before you turn the screw driver), it should come out no problem.

If not, swing by one of these days or mail the thing to me.
 
Another reason is that those screws are loc-tited. On that note, make sure you loc tite the replacement screws.
